//! Type definitions and `dodrio::Render` implementation for a collection of
//! todo items.
use crate::controller::Controller;
use crate::todo::{Todo, TodoActions};
use crate::visibility::Visibility;
use crate::{keys, utils};
use dodrio::{bumpalo, Node, Render, RenderContext, RootRender, VdomWeak};
use serde::{Deserialize, Serialize};
use std::marker::PhantomData;
use std::mem;
use wasm_bindgen::{prelude::*, JsCast};
/// A collection of todos.
#[derive(Default, Serialize, Deserialize)]
#[serde(rename = "todos-dodrio", bound = "")]
pub struct Todos<C = Controller> {
todos: Vec<Todo<C>>,
#[serde(skip)]
draft: String,
#[serde(skip)]
visibility: Visibility,
#[serde(skip)]
_controller: PhantomData<C>,
}
/// Actions for `Todos` that can be triggered by UI interactions.
pub trait TodosActions: 'static + TodoActions {
/// Toggle the completion state of all todo items.
fn toggle_all(root: &mut dyn RootRender, vdom: VdomWeak);
/// Update the draft todo item's text.
fn update_draft(root: &mut dyn RootRender, vdom: VdomWeak, draft: String);
/// Finish the current draft todo item and add it to the collection of
/// todos.
fn finish_draft(root: &mut dyn RootRender, vdom: VdomWeak);
/// Change the todo item visibility filtering to the given `Visibility`.
fn change_visibility(root: &mut dyn RootRender, vdom: VdomWeak, vis: Visibility);
/// Delete all completed todo items.
fn delete_completed(root: &mut dyn RootRender, vdom: VdomWeak);
}
impl<C> Todos<C> {
/// Construct a new todos set.
///
/// If an existing set is available in local storage, then use that,
/// otherwise create a new set.
pub fn new() -> Self
where
C: Default,
{
Self::from_local_storage().unwrap_or_default()
}
/// Deserialize a set of todos from local storage.
pub fn from_local_storage() -> Option<Self> {
utils::local_storage()
.get("todomvc-dodrio")
.ok()
.and_then(|opt| opt)
.and_then(|json| serde_json::from_str(&json).ok())
}
/// Serialize this set of todos to local storage.
pub fn save_to_local_storage(&self) {
let serialized = serde_json::to_string(self).unwrap_throw();
utils::local_storage()
.set("todomvc-dodrio", &serialized)
.unwrap_throw();
}
/// Add a new todo item to this collection.
pub fn add_todo(&mut self, todo: Todo<C>) {
self.todos.push(todo);
}
/// Delete the todo with the given id.
pub fn delete_todo(&mut self, id: usize) {
self.todos.remove(id);
self.fix_ids();
}
/// Delete all completed todo items.
pub fn delete_completed(&mut self) {
self.todos.retain(|t| !t.is_complete());
self.fix_ids();
}
// Fix all todo identifiers so that they match their index once again.
fn fix_ids(&mut self) {
for (id, todo) in self.todos.iter_mut().enumerate() {
todo.set_id(id);
}
}
/// Get a shared slice of the underlying set of todo items.
pub fn todos(&self) -> &[Todo<C>] {
&self.todos
}
/// Get an exclusive slice of the underlying set of todo items.
pub fn todos_mut(&mut self) -> &mut [Todo<C>] {
&mut self.todos
}
/// Set the draft todo item text.
pub fn set_draft<S: Into<String>>(&mut self, draft: S) {
self.draft = draft.into();
}
/// Take the current draft text and replace it with an empty string.
pub fn take_draft(&mut self) -> String {
mem::replace(&mut self.draft, String::new())
}
/// Get the current visibility for these todos.
pub fn visibility(&self) -> Visibility {
self.visibility
}
/// Set the visibility for these todoS.
pub fn set_visibility(&mut self, vis: Visibility) {
self.visibility = vis;
}
}
/// Rendering helpers.
impl<C: TodosActions> Todos<C> {
fn header<'a>(&self, cx: &mut RenderContext<'a>) -> Node<'a> {
use dodrio::builder::*;
header(&cx)
.attr("class", "header")
.children([
h1(&cx).children([text("todos")]).finish(),
input(&cx)
.on("input", |root, vdom, event| {
let input = event
.target()
.unwrap_throw()
.unchecked_into::<web_sys::HtmlInputElement>();
C::update_draft(root, vdom, input.value());
})
.on("keydown", |root, vdom, event| {
let event = event.unchecked_into::<web_sys::KeyboardEvent>();
if event.key_code() == keys::ENTER {
C::finish_draft(root, vdom);
}
})
.attr("class", "new-todo")
.attr("placeholder", "What needs to be done?")
.attr("autofocus", "")
.attr(
"value",
bumpalo::format!(in cx.bump, "{}", self.draft).into_bump_str(),
)
.finish(),
])
.finish()
}
fn todos_list<'a>(&self, cx: &mut RenderContext<'a>) -> Node<'a> {
use dodrio::{builder::*, bumpalo::collections::Vec};
let mut todos = Vec::with_capacity_in(self.todos.len(), cx.bump);
todos.extend(
self.todos
.iter()
.filter(|t| match self.visibility {
Visibility::All => true,
Visibility::Active => !t.is_complete(),
Visibility::Completed => t.is_complete(),
})
.map(|t| t.render(cx)),
);
section(&cx)
.attr("class", "main")
.attr(
"visibility",
if self.todos.is_empty() {
"hidden"
} else {
"visible"
},
)
.children([
input(&cx)
.attr("class", "toggle-all")
.attr("id", "toggle-all")
.attr("type", "checkbox")
.attr("name", "toggle")
.bool_attr("checked", self.todos.iter().all(|t| t.is_complete()))
.on("click", |root, vdom, _event| {
C::toggle_all(root, vdom);
})
.finish(),
label(&cx)
.attr("for", "toggle-all")
.children([text("Mark all as complete")])
.finish(),
ul(&cx).attr("class", "todo-list").children(todos).finish(),
])
.finish()
}
fn footer<'a>(&self, cx: &mut RenderContext<'a>) -> Node<'a> {
use dodrio::builder::*;
let completed_count = self.todos.iter().filter(|t| t.is_complete()).count();
let incomplete_count = self.todos.len() - completed_count;
let items_left = if incomplete_count == 1 {
" item left"
} else {
" items left"
};
let incomplete_count = bumpalo::format!(in cx.bump, "{}", incomplete_count);
let clear_completed_text = bumpalo::format!(
in cx.bump,
"Clear completed ({})",
self.todos.iter().filter(|t| t.is_complete()).count()
);
footer(&cx)
.attr("class", "footer")
.bool_attr("hidden", self.todos.is_empty())
.children([
span(&cx)
.attr("class", "todo-count")
.children([
strong(&cx)
.children([text(incomplete_count.into_bump_str())])
.finish(),
text(items_left),
])
.finish(),
ul(&cx)
.attr("class", "filters")
.children([
self.visibility_swap(cx, "#/", Visibility::All),
self.visibility_swap(cx, "#/active", Visibility::Active),
self.visibility_swap(cx, "#/completed", Visibility::Completed),
])
.finish(),
button(&cx)
.on("click", |root, vdom, _event| {
C::delete_completed(root, vdom);
})
.attr("class", "clear-completed")
.bool_attr("hidden", completed_count == 0)
.children([text(clear_completed_text.into_bump_str())])
.finish(),
])
.finish()
}
fn visibility_swap<'a>(
&self,
cx: &mut RenderContext<'a>,
url: &'static str,
target_vis: Visibility,
) -> Node<'a> {
use dodrio::builder::*;
li(&cx)
.on("click", move |root, vdom, _event| {
C::change_visibility(root, vdom, target_vis);
})
.children([a(&cx)
.attr("href", url)
.attr(
"class",
if self.visibility == target_vis {
"selected"
} else {
""
},
)
.children([text(target_vis.label())])
.finish()])
.finish()
}
}
impl<'a, C: TodosActions> Render<'a> for Todos<C> {
fn render(&self, cx: &mut RenderContext<'a>) -> Node<'a> {
use dodrio::builder::*;
div(&cx)
.children([self.header(cx), self.todos_list(cx), self.footer(cx)])
.finish()
}
}
